Common Flash_merge.exe Errors on Windows

Confronting errors linked to flash_merge.exe can be a daunting task due to the diversity of underlying causes, which might include software incompatibility, obsolete drivers, or even malware presence. In the section below, we've enumerated the most frequently encountered errors related to flash_merge.exe in order to assist you in comprehending and potentially rectifying the issues.

  • Flash_merge.exe - System Error: This warning is displayed when the system experiences a problem due to an executable file. This could occur because of software interference, corruption of system files, or lack of necessary system resources.
  • Flash_merge.exe - Bad Image Error:: This error message indicates that Windows cannot run flash_merge.exe because it's either corrupted, or the associated DLL file is missing or corrupted.
  • Flash_merge.exe File Not Executing: This alert shows up when the system cannot initiate the executable file. Possible causes could include file corruption, inappropriate file permissions, or a lack of necessary system resources.
  • Error 0xc0000142: This alert pops up when an application fails to initiate properly. This could be the result of software glitches, damaged files, or complications with the Windows registry.
  • Missing Flash_merge.exe File: This alert comes up when the system is unable to locate the necessary executable file. Flash_merge.exe could have been removed, relocated, or the provided file path might be incorrect.

Step 1: Uninstall the Problematic Software

Step 1: Uninstall the Problematic Software Thumbnail
  1. Press the Windows key.

  2. Type Control Panel in the search bar and press Enter.

  3. Click on Uninstall a program under Programs.

  4. Find and click on the software, then click Uninstall.

Step 2: Restart Your Computer

Step 2: Restart Your Computer Thumbnail
  1. After the uninstall process is complete, restart your computer.

Step 3: Reinstall the Software

Step 3: Reinstall the Software Thumbnail
  1. Visit the official website of the software developer.

  2. Download the latest version of the software.

  3. Open the downloaded file and follow the instructions to install the software.

Step 4: Check if the Problem is Solved

Step 4: Check if the Problem is Solved Thumbnail
  1. After the program is installed, check if the flash_merge.exe problem persists.

How to guide on updating the device drivers on your system. flash_merge.exe errors can be caused by outdated or incompatible drivers.

Step 1: Open Device Manager

Step 1: Open Device Manager Thumbnail
  1. Press the Windows key.

  2. Type Device Manager in the search bar and press Enter.

Step 2: Identify the Driver to Update

Step 2: Identify the Driver to Update Thumbnail
  1. In the Device Manager window, locate the device whose driver you want to update.

  2. Click on the arrow or plus sign next to the device category to expand it.

  3. Right-click on the device and select Update driver.

Step 3: Update the Driver

Step 3: Update the Driver Thumbnail
  1. In the next window, select Search automatically for updated driver software.

  2. Follow the prompts to install the driver update.

Step 4: Restart Your Computer

Step 4: Restart Your Computer Thumbnail
  1. After the driver update is installed, restart your computer.
